Hynes Industries describes itself as a precision-engineered, custom roll form metal solutions provider, with experience tied to markets including truck trailer manufacturing, solar, automated material handling, and industrial & commercial building products (About Us). The company also describes its workplace as “family-oriented” and “community-based,” with a culture grounded in “belief in your people” (About Us). Before you browse: building a practical job fit for manufacturing work

A strong application strategy starts with selecting roles that match your experience level and the production context implied by the posting. For industrial and manufacturing-related jobs, fit is often more than just the title.

Align on department and function

Because Hynes highlights multiple business areas (About Us), job descriptions may map to different types of functions—such as manufacturing operations, technical/engineering support, or related operational roles. Start by identifying which function you’re most qualified for, then scan postings for duties that clearly match your background.

Match location and shift realities

If a role is on-site, location and shift requirements become decision factors. Treat commuting feasibility and scheduling as part of the initial filter, not something to resolve after you apply.

Confirm your experience level and safety/quality expectations

Industrial postings often include expectations around process execution, quality, and safety. Even when your experience isn’t an exact “department match,” prioritize roles where your past work clearly transfers to the equipment/process environment described in the duties.
